Which action confirms the parole certificate is valid?

Explanation:
Verifying a parole document’s legitimacy comes down to confirming the parole certificate with the issuing authority. This direct check ensures the certificate is authentic, properly issued, and linked to the correct offender, with the right signatures, seals, and dates, and that it hasn’t been altered or expired. While other steps like noting a current parole warrant, reviewing rights, or collecting supporting documents are important parts of handling a case, they don’t establish the certificate’s validity by themselves.
